Latest Patents: Paschina holds two patents, with his latest being titled "Automatic hardware ZLW insertion for IPU image streams." This patent describes a sophisticated system that includes a memory and processor designed to enhance image stream processes. The memory is tasked with storing imaging data, while the processor is responsible for receiving image stream requests and determining the appropriate data transfer type. Notably, this invention allows the processor to insert a zero-length write (ZLW) instruction before an image stream request. This action occurs when the request begins on a different page compared to the current page in page history or when it crosses a page boundary.
